I'm a bit confused. :-(

I'm looking to buy a new P4 mainboard with DDR333 memory support (afaik DDR333 is also denoted as PC2700), I had a look at the THG website and found the articles about the i845G chipset which states it supports this type of memory.

I'm looking to buy an Asus mainboard [the P4B533-V(M)] for instance, as I have very good experiences with Asus in the past. I went to the Asus and after that the Intel websites to find out more about this chipset.
Much to my surprise I found at both of these websites that the fastest memory supported by the i845G chipset is PC2100 (DDR266)

(http://www.asus.com/mb/socket478/p4b533-vm/overview.htm)
(http://www.intel.com/design/chipsets/845g/index.htm?iid=ipp_dlc_procp4p+body_link11&)

To be sure I checked also on the MSI website and again PC2100 is mentioned as max memory support. So now I'm confused, does or doesn't this chipset support PC2700. And if so why don't these manufacturers state this on their websites, especially Intel??

It is a little confusing. Basically Intel will only "validate" the i845G to DDR266. However you can "overclock" the memory clock to 166MHz which would give you DDR333. THG (and probably other places) have reported success in doing this. Intel has introduced new chipsets (i845PE & i845PG?) which officially supports DDR333. The early buzz seem to be very positive on these new Intel sets. As for me, I didn't want to wait and instead got a ASUS P4S8X which uses SiS648 chipset. In my hands this has work well (to DDR333 with "mildly" agressive memory timing), but others have reported some difficults. Also SiS 645(DX) will also support DDR333.
